REAR SUSPENSION
Spring preload adjustment:
The rear shock absorber has five adjustment positions for different load or riding conditions.
Remove the right saddlebag and right side cover. Use the pin spanner in the tool kit to adjust
the rear shock.
Position 1 is for a light load and smooth road conditions.
Position 2 is the standard position.
Positions 3 to 5 increase spring preload for a stiffer rear suspension, and can be used
when the motorcycle is more heavily loaded.
Rebound Damping adjustment:
The rebound damping adjuster has four adjustment positions. To adjust to the standard
position, proceed as follows:
1. Turn the adjuster clockwise until it stops.
2. Turn the adjuster counterclockwise 1 turn (model equipped with CBS/ABS/TCS: 1/2
turn) to align the punch mark on the adjuster with the reference mark.
